New Lane Memorial Elementary School Celebrates 100th Year of Fire Prevention Week

New Lane Memorial Elementary School students celebrated Fire Prevention Week from Sunday, October 9 to Saturday, October 15. This year marks the 100th anniversary of Fire Prevention Week.

In honor of Fire Prevention Week, firefighters from the Selden Fire Department visited the New Lane Memorial Elementary School to speak to students on how to prevent fires and what to do if there is a fire. The elementary school students were also able to ask questions and learn about the fire safety types of equipment the firefighters use in their fire trucks.

“It was wonderful to have the Selden Fire Department visit our students to educate them on fire safety,” said Phyllis Saltz, Principal of New Lane Memorial Elementary School. “Thank you to the Selden Fire Department for taking the time to visit us and teach our students the essentials of fire safety!”
